PQC Migration for Mobile and Fixed Operators

Telecommunications infrastructure is both a target for quantum attacks and a carrier for the traffic that PQC migration must protect. 5G-AKA remains anchored in a symmetric long-term subscriber key, but 5G introduced public-key mechanisms 4G never had, most visibly SUCI subscriber-identity concealment. Roaming interfaces, SIM provisioning, and interconnection agreements all have cryptographic dependencies. And the 6G standardization window that will lock in architectural choices for the next decade is open now.

This course covers PQC migration for mobile and fixed operators, aligned with GSMA PQ.01-PQ.07 guidance and the PQC Migration Framework Telecommunications extension.

Course Outline

Module 1. Telecommunications Cryptographic Dependencies

5G-AKA and its symmetric long-term subscriber key, and why that places it differently from the public-key mechanisms 5G introduced. SUCI identity concealment and the public-key dependencies that carry real quantum exposure. Roaming interface cryptography (SEPP/N32). SIM provisioning and OTA update security. Core network authentication. Transport network encryption. The distinction between access network and core network migration.

Module 2. GSMA Guidance and Standards

GSMA PQ.01 through PQ.07: what each document covers and requires. 3GPP standardization status. ETSI quantum-safe cryptography work. The 6G standardization window and why choices made now will persist for a decade.

Module 3. Operator Migration Strategy

Migration sequencing for mobile operators: core network, transport, access, services. SIM replacement and remote provisioning implications. Roaming partner coordination. Vendor equipment timeline dependencies. The interconnection agreement challenge.

Module 4. Implementation and Testing

Testing PQC in live network environments. Handover and roaming testing with PQC algorithms. Performance impact on latency-sensitive services. Regulatory compliance during transition.
